Sam’s Club has launched a micro-site called Savings Made Simple.  The site is pretty fantastic and has a Savings Calculator, News Articles, and a Savings Forum.

There is a great article by the Coupon Mom (Stephanie Nelson), one of my favorite people.  I use her site a lot and it was interesting to read her smart tips for saving money and shopping in bulk.  I also was impressed with the Savings Calculator on the site.  You just punch in what you typically spend in a month on certain items and the calculator tells you what you could have saved by shopping at Sam’s Club.
